What they do

A Restaurant or Food Service Manager oversees daily operations at a restaurant or an institution that serves meals such as a college or hospital. Hires, trains and supervises food service workers, manages meal and work schedules, supervises supply orders, food preparation and the quality of food and service, and monitors compliance with health regulations.

$56,131 / year median in Texas

+14% projected growth
